
I’ve done it again! I’ve been sucked into buying yet another Next beauty box. This one is particularly special as £4 per net item sold from this collection will be donated to Future Dreams Breast Cancer Charity.
It’s fantastic that a portion of money goes towards charity as well as it being really affordable to customers. I’ve known so many to get breast cancer, or another type of cancer and my heart goes out to them. Hopefully the money raised can make a difference to someone or many women’s lives.
In this box (contains worth over £120) you get:
GLAMGLOW Supermud clearing treatment
Bobbi Brown Smokey Eye Mascara
Bumble & Bumble Pret-a-Powder Post Workout Dry Shampoo Mist
Clinque Take The Day Off Cleansing Balm
Origins Ginzing Refreshing Eye Cream
Aveda Botanical Repair Intensive Strengthening Masque (Light)
Too Faced Born This Way Natural Nudes Eyeshadow Palette

I haven’t tried any of these apart from the Origins Ginzing Eye Cream which I adore! I tried the Glamglow face mask the other night and really enjoyed using it as well as the Clinque cleansing balm, which was super nourishing.
However, I am really excited to try Bumble and Bumble’s dry shampoo and the Too Faced palette. I mean, just look at those shades!
